The setting is the point here: a Sunday-morning stall row on the Rye foreshore with the bay a few metres away. The stall list leans craft and gift over food producer, and the food-stall density is lower than Red Hill or Balnarring. Best treated as a casual browse en route to or from a swim, a coffee at one of the Rye cafés, or a longer Mornington-tip day. In summer the atmosphere does the work; in winter it can be very small.
